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_021258.4(IL22RA1):c.1153G>T(p.Val385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000352 in 1,419,210 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
IL22RA1 (HGNC:13700): (interleukin 22 receptor subunit alpha 1) The protein encoded by this gene belongs to the class II cytokine receptor family, and has been shown to be a receptor for interleukin 22 (IL22). IL22 receptor is a protein complex that consists of this protein and interleukin 10 receptor, beta (IL10BR/CRFB4), a subunit also shared by the receptor complex for interleukin 10 (IL10). This gene and interleukin 28 receptor, alpha (IL28RA) form a cytokine receptor gene cluster in the chromosomal region 1p36.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sOct 17, 2023The c.1153G>T (p.V385F) alteration is located in exon 7 (coding exon 7) of the IL22RA1 gene. This alteration results from a G to T substitution at nucleotide position 1153, causing the valine (V) at amino acid position 385 to be replaced by a phenylalanine (F).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
